I'm trying to install Ubuntu 6.06 LTS onto a Dell 2950, with a PERC 5/i RAID controller and two dual-core Xeon processors.
I found this thread which suggests that it should be possible, if I modify the initramfs after the install but before rebooting. So I tried following the instructions given there (as root, i.e. after "sudo -s" in a terminal window):
mount /dev/sdb2 /target
chroot /target echo "megaraid_sas" >> /etc/mkinitramfs/modules mkinitramfs -o /boot/initrd.img-2.6.15-23-386 2.6.15-23-386 (That's all transcribed by hand, so I might have mistyped something.) The instructions at the linked thread specify a different kernel, but I based my mkinitramfs command on what's already in /boot. (I am trying to use the x86 install CD, partly because I've seen reports of trouble with the x86-64 version and partly for compatibility with our other machines.)
However, after that change, I am still unable to boot the installed system. The graphical boot screen shows "Mounting root file system..." and then after a pause "Waiting for root file system..." and hangs there; if I CTRL-ALT-F1 to tty1, I see "Uncompressing Linux... OK, booting the kernel." and then after a *long* pause, "ALERT!!! /dev/sdb2 does not exist, dropping to a shell!!!" and I end up in a busybox shell (presumably compiled into the kernel). Unfortunately it has no dmesg command, although I also think at this point there's no kernel output other than what's on the screen.
(That's the same behaviour I had before tweaking the initramfs as suggested in the linked thread.)
